Broome County Housing Study

The study identified significant gaps in Broome County’s housing stock, particularly for first-time homebuyers, young professionals, and higher-income renters, creating barriers to workforce recruitment and community vitality. It recommends a two-pronged approach: revitalizing existing housing stock in targeted neighborhoods with incentives and gap financing, while also promoting new construction at moderate price points to meet current market demand. The conclusions highlight the need for collaboration between public, private, and nonprofit entities to achieve these housing goals.
